India electricity supply down 1.1% in December, declines for fifth straight month

Power supply fell to 101.92 billion units in December, down 1.1% from 103.04 billion units last year, an analysis of daily load despatch data from state-run Power System Operation Corp Ltd showed. Lower electricity supply could mean a fifth consecutive fall in power demand, as electricity deficit in India is marginal.

Electricity demand is seen by economists as an important indicator of industrial output and a deceleration could point to a further slowdown.
